I worked for a leading bookies, and we are breifed that we are getting a visit over the next few weeks. The usual thing we spot is reading the special offers in the window and them coming in and asking about them. They only place a pound bet and then ask for the odds. They usually decline the offer of a free hot beverage but always ask to use the customer toilet.
Oh and they stare at you as they enter, usually waiting to see if you have noticed them!! When you have a queue sometimes we could only smile to acknowledge.
It does make an interesting game, spot the MS - I just hoped i managed a high score if they ever came in, our bonus depended on it lolBSC member 137
